Transaction eca1c741400a69840007c61aef42244823db0a5b4df856bb47da7c47b00873a0
1 Input
1 Output
-
eca1c741400a69840007c61aef42244823db0a5b4df856bb47da7c47b00873a0:0
- value
- 12880248
- script pubkey
- OP_0 OP_PUSHBYTES_20 68e71f2a6669c09b1a0912c311324b7d0aa17ccb
- address
- bc1qdrn372nxd8qfkxsfztp3zvjt0592zlxtdz2w30